TECHNICAL FIELD
[0001] The present application relates to the field of flexible material processing, in particular to a flattening method and device for flexible material. BACKGROUND
[0002] In actual use, flexible material needs to be flattened before being detected. The existing flattening method for flexible material is to flatten the flexible material by rigid material, which may cause pressure injury or damage to the flexible material. To solve this problem, the industry usually looks for super-flexible film flattening products, but the flexible film is not rigid enough to effectively position, compress and shape the flexible material.
[0003] To solve the above problems, the inventor attempts to use a non-contact flattening method, which places the flexible material on the flat part of the bearing platform and performs vacuum suction treatment on the vacuum suction micro-holes in the bearing platform, intending to adsorb the flexible material from the end of the bearing platform away from the flexible material to achieve the effect of flattening the flexible material. However, it is found that this point suction method does not uniformly apply force to the flexible material, and the flattening effect is not good. In addition, the inventor also attempts to use an air gun to spray gas from the end of the flexible material away from the bearing platform, but finds that the gas in the air gun vibrates and cannot keep the flexible material fixed in the state of flattening. [0027] like Figures 1 to 3 As shown, the method for flattening flexible materials in this embodiment includes the following steps: The flexible material 2 may include a detection unit 21 and an auxiliary material unit 22 surrounding the detection unit 21.
[0028] The flexible material 2 is fixed on the support platform 1 by the positioning unit 3 with the hollow part 31. The positioning unit 3 can be pressed on the auxiliary material part 22. The hollow part 31 can be set in correspondence with the detection part 21, so that the detection part 21 is located inside the hollow part 31. At this time, the detection part 21 may have a part that is raised relative to the support platform 1.
[0029] The end of the hollow part 31 away from the bearing platform 1 is closed to seal the hollow part 31, thereby preventing gas from flowing out after positive pressure gas is injected into the hollow part 31.
[0030] Positive pressure gas is injected into the hollow part 31, forming a positive pressure that applies pressure to all surfaces in the hollow part 31. The positive pressure gas inside the hollow part 31 can use the pressure to flatten the flexible material 2 onto the support platform 1, thereby flattening the detection part 21.
[0031] Specifically, the flexible material may include a PU film and a wafer disposed on the PU film detection unit 21, and the pressure of the hollow part is set to 0.5MPa-0.7MPa.
[0032] In this embodiment, a gas source injects high-pressure gas into the hollow portion 31 through the airflow channel 33 on the positioning unit 3, and sets the preset pressure value of the hollow portion 31 to 0.6 MPa. When the pressure value inside the hollow portion 31 reaches 0.6 MPa, the gas source is shut off. The positive pressure gas inside the hollow portion 31 forms a positive pressure that applies pressure to all surfaces, and the positive pressure presses the detection part 21 against the flat surface 11, thereby making the detection part 21 fit tightly against the flat surface 11, thus achieving the effect of flattening the detection part 21.
[0033] By using the above method, the detection section 21 in the flexible material 2 can be flattened without contacting the flexible material 2, thus allowing for subsequent testing and avoiding damage to the flexible material 2. Furthermore, because a preset pressure value is set throughout the method, the force exerted by the positive pressure gas on all parts of the detection section 21 remains the same, resulting in a better flattening effect.

[0035] The flatting device includes:
[0036] A bearing platform 1, which can have a flat surface 11, so that the bearing platform 1 can bear the material and other mechanisms. The flat surface 11 can be arranged in such a way that the flexible material 2 can be kept in close contact with the flat surface 11 under the action of the gas pressure in the hollow part 31, so that the flexible material 2 can be kept flat. The other parts of the bearing platform 1 except the flat surface 11 can be adjusted according to actual needs, so that the bearing platform 1 can be arranged in different working conditions. The bearing platform 1 can be made of rigid material, so that the bearing platform 1 can provide a flat reference surface.
[0037] A positioning unit 3, which can be arranged on the side of the supplementary material part 22 away from the flat surface 11. The positioning unit 3 can have a hollow part 31 penetrating in the direction perpendicular to the flat surface 11. So that after the positioning unit 3 contacts with the flexible material 2, the positioning unit 3 can contact with the supplementary material part 22, and the hollow part 31 corresponds to the detection part 21, so as to prevent the positioning part from contacting with the detection part 21 and affecting the detection part 21. The positioning unit 3 can be provided with an air flow channel 33 penetrating from the hollow part 31 to the side away from the hollow part 31. The air flow channel 33 away from the hollow part 31 can include an air pipe joint 6, so that the positive pressure gas can enter the hollow part 31 from the air flow channel 33 through the air pipe joint 6. The positioning unit 3 can be made of rigid material, so that the positioning unit 3 can fasten the supplementary material part 22.
[0038] A sealing part 4, which can be arranged on the side of the hollow part 31 away from the bearing platform 1 and seal the hollow part 31, so that the positive pressure gas in the hollow part 31 can be accumulated in the hollow part 31 and the positive pressure gas in the hollow part 31 is sealed without leakage.
[0039] A gas source (not shown in the figure), which can communicate with the air flow channel 33 to input gas into the air flow channel 33 and make the hollow part 31 reach a preset pressure. The gas source can stop inputting gas into the air flow channel 33 when the hollow part 31 reaches the preset pressure. The input gas can be positive pressure gas, so that the inside of the hollow part 31 can reach the preset pressure value faster.
[0040] In the embodiment, the gas source comprises an electric control cabinet, a high-pressure gas pipe controllable by the electric control cabinet, and a solenoid valve electrically connected to the electric control cabinet. The electric control cabinet controls the high-pressure gas pipe to communicate with the gas pipe joint 6 and causes the solenoid valve electrically connected to the electric control cabinet to be in an open state, the high-pressure gas pipe injects high-pressure gas into the gas pipe joint 6 and causes the high-pressure gas to flow into the hollow part 31 through the gas flow channel 33, and finally, the solenoid valve is cut off when the gas in the hollow part 31 reaches a preset pressure value, so that the gas path of the high-pressure gas pipe is closed. In this process, the positive pressure gas in the hollow part 31 forms a positive pressure force pressing all surfaces, and the detection part 21 is pressed towards the flat part 11 by the positive pressure force, so that the detection part 21 is tightly attached to the flat part 11, thereby achieving the effect of flattening the detection part 21.
[0041] Through the above structure, by forming a sealed hollow part 31, the positive pressure gas therein can apply a force to the detection part 21 and flatten the detection part 21. In this process, direct contact with the flexible material 2 can be avoided to prevent bruising or damaging the flexible material 2, and in addition, uniform stress on the flexible material 2 can be achieved and the position of the flattened flexible material 2 can be fixed, thereby improving the flattening effect of the flexible material.
[0042] Specifically, the sealing part 4 can be transparent optical glass, so that the sealing part 4 functions as a viewing window for the hollow part 31, facilitating observation and monitoring of the flexible material 2 in the hollow part 31. Thereby, the operator can intuitively understand the working environment in the hollow part 31 and further judge the flattening state of the flexible material 2.
[0043] Specifically, as shown in Figures 1 to 3 , the fixing unit 5 can be adjacent to the positioning unit 3 and the bearing platform 1, and the fixing unit 5 is threadedly connected with the positioning unit 3 and the bearing platform 1. Thereby, the fixing unit 5 fixes the positioning unit 3 and the bearing platform 1 relative to each other. The reinforcing effect of the positioning unit 3 and the bearing platform 1 can be achieved. The fixing unit 5 and the positioning unit 3 and the bearing unit can be threadedly connected. Except that the gas flow channel 33 communicating with the gas pipe joint 6 communicates with the hollow part 31, the rest can be thread holes 34 isolated from the hollow part 31.
[0044] Specifically, as shown in Figure 1 and Figure 2 , a plurality of fixing units 5 can be arranged at one end of the positioning unit 3 away from the hollow part 31. As shown in Figure 1As shown in the embodiment, the projection shape of the positioning unit 3 on the section perpendicular to the thickness thereof is a rectangular ring, and the positioning unit 3 is arranged around the four sides of the positioning unit 3, thereby fixing the four sides of the positioning unit 3 and improving the stability of the entire device. In addition, the direct fixing between the positioning unit 3 and the bearing platform 1 can be avoided, thereby saving the positioning unit 3, and the positioning unit 3 does not need to be arranged beyond the auxiliary part 22 to be fixed with the bearing platform 1. Of course, in other alternative embodiments, when the projection shape of the positioning unit 3 on the section perpendicular to the thickness thereof is a circular ring or other shapes, the fixing unit 5 can be arranged outside to fix the positioning unit 3.
[0045] Specifically, as shown in the embodiment, Figure 1 The positioning unit 3 can have a first plane parallel to the plane part 11 and a second plane 32, and the side of the sealing part 4 close to the plane part 11 can be parallel to the plane part 11, so that in use, the first plane can abut against the auxiliary part 22, and the second plane 32 can abut against the sealing part 4. The first plane and the auxiliary part 22 can seal the part of the hollow part 31 close to the flexible material 2, and the second plane 32 and the sealing part 4 can seal the part of the hollow part 31 close to the sealing part 4, thereby improving the sealing of the positive pressure gas in the hollow part 31.
[0046] Specifically, the sealing part 4 can be fixedly connected with the positioning unit 3, so that the sealing part 4 and the positioning unit 3 have stronger binding force, and the positive pressure gas inside the hollow part 31 can be prevented from pushing the sealing part 4 away from the positioning unit 3 during use of the device, thereby improving the use stability of the entire flat device for the flexible material.
[0047] Specifically, as shown in the embodiment, Figure 1 and Figure 2 The bearing platform 1 can be provided with a groove 12 recessed from the edge thereof to the inside thereof, and the groove 12 can be arranged corresponding to the air pipe joint 6, that is, the groove 12 can be arranged at the position corresponding to the air pipe joint 6 on the bearing platform 1, and the size of the groove 12 can be slightly larger than that of the air pipe joint 6, thereby preventing interference between the air pipe joint 6 and the bearing platform 1.
[0048] Specifically, the bearing platform 1 and the positioning unit 3 can both be aluminum plates, and since the aluminum plate has the characteristics of light weight and high hardness, the flexible material 2 in the bearing platform 1 and the positioning unit 3 can be fixed on the reference surface formed by the plane part 11, thereby improving the fixing effect of the flexible material 2.
